‘R’ is trying to implement one plan after another about Bangladesh

The German forest-based news portal The Mirror Asia has reported that the Indian intelligence agency ‘RA’ is implementing one plan after another on Hasinatto’s Bangladesh.

According to the newspaper report, India’s first project with Bangladesh is for the period from September 1 to November 30. The purpose of this project is to present the narrative that Hefazat Shibir and Hizb ut Tahrir have imposed on the Yunus government through the left. At the same time, there is a long relationship with ‘R’ to explain the parts of Hefajat Islam that, ‘Dr. Yunus Sudkhor, he is a US agent, is not a good Muslim by any means. In a few days this government may recognize the rights of homosexuals.’ This group has also been instructed not to go into unity with religious parties with Jamaat.

Mirror Asia reports that the ‘Bangla Mission’ is emphasizing Hizb ut Tahrir’s association with the agitators and creating a fear about their ideology. The Mirror Asia noted that a journalist working in Delhi, West Bengal, had already spoken at length with the three ‘anti-US imperialist’ former student leaders.

According to the report, India’s priority at the moment is to create instability by identifying the current government as a Hizb-Tahrir and Shibir-influenced government by November without giving the youth a chance to form a party. On the other hand, talking about the election environment, bringing the Awami League into open politics within the next six months.

Mirror Asia reports that a sub-group has already been formed within the ‘Raw’ to carry out the ‘Bangla Mission’. Recently, the Bangladesh intelligence sub-team ‘Bangla Mission’ has taken into account the comments of Hasnat Abdullah, one of the coordinators of the anti-discrimination student movement about the chicken neck, and the statements of some of the coordinators about the Seven Sisters.

Facebook status of each of them is translated in Hindi and English and given in the table of Victor-2. Victor-2 is a cell of ‘R’ where the latest decisions regarding Bangladesh are taken. According to the newspaper, India is walking in two boats at the moment with regard to Bangladesh. Diplomats have been instructed to maintain contact with the BNP and Jatiya Party besides monitoring the movements of the new government and student agitators in Dhaka. A source in the Prime Minister’s Office of India says that they do not want to open the ‘door’ of talks with Jamaat-e-Islami now, but they want to open the ‘window’.

According to the report, two think tanks in Delhi and one in Assam have been researching the agitation coordinators and their ideology for the last 20 days. Reports from all three organizations say that the party that the coordinators will go on to form will be an anti-India political party. Even if they espouse left-wing revolutionary ideas, religion will not conflict with them. As a result of this ideal, the political space of the leftists in the country will be completely empty, researchers are pointing out. As a result, they are expecting a conflict between the youth and the left. It is from that thought that ‘R’ is in touch with the leftist student leaders.

Apart from this, if they want to give a philosophical and historical basis to the recent mass uprising, they think that the one-shot narrative of the liberation war in Bangladesh’s national history will be undermined, which will weaken India’s soft power in Dhaka. If the spirit of this mass uprising is adopted on a larger scale, the second plan of ‘RA’, ‘Resetel Awami League-2025’, will also become very difficult.

Mirror Asia probed over the past week what might be India’s next plans, with Hasina recently shifted to a government residence in South Delhi. However, another source says that Hasina is currently staying in a building secured by the Intelligence Bureau (IB), India’s domestic intelligence agency. India has had dozens of high-profile meetings with him recently. India’s National Security Adviser and RAW chief himself is looking after Sheikh Hasina and has frequent meetings with her, according to the report.

According to the report, his daughter Saima Wazed Putul is regularly meeting with the former Prime Minister of Bangladesh to restore his morale. Hasina is also doing yoga regularly. Seeing the security arrangements at Hasina’s new residence and the appointment of her personal officers, a Bengali journalist working in Delhi told The Mirror Asia that Hasina will stay in Delhi for a long time.

A Delhi-based researcher on Bangladesh affairs told The Mirror Asia, Hasina has an extraordinary ability to make a comeback. He made comebacks in ’81 and ’96. Surviving a grenade attack in 2004, he made an unstoppable comeback in 2009. He thinks Hasina can return again, maybe she will lead the team from Delhi. But there will be a crisis if the history of mass uprising is made a part of national history, literary works and an ideological basis.

According to the report, India does not want to give more time to students. Delhi thinks that Awami League will be safer during BNP period. Awami League can get a political space if BNP’s various crises come to the fore, if BNP-Jamaat power conflict arises. According to Mirror Asia’s report, when the Hasina government ordered the students to shoot on sight on July 16, the situation gradually turned in favor of the government. Later, at the special request of Sheikh Hasina and under the direct supervision of India’s security adviser, 400 officers trained by Bangladesh ‘RA’ went to Dhaka. According to them, they returned to Delhi on July 28 after suppressing the Kashmiri-style movement. According to Mirror Asia, Raw was not aware of the subsequent situation. They succumbed to CIA tactics on August 5. However, Sheikh Hasina’s decision to leave Delhi on August 5 was not taken suddenly. Hasina and India’s National Security Advisor Ajit Doval made this plan as part of Plan ‘C’ on August 2. India sees South Asia as its security region, hence there is an intervention of the Security Adviser in these countries.

According to the report, after August 5, Raw plans to stage a counter-revolution under the guise of a minority rally on August 10. A large number of Indian journalists were also present in Dhaka that day. If that fails, a second cure is planned for August 15. That too fails. However, the Ansar rebellion planned in the country recently was taken internally by the Awami League. The Mirror Asia did not find any association with him.

Pointing out that Mirror Asia is keeping an eye on Hasina and India’s next plans, Mirror Asia also spoke to two journalists who monitor Bangladesh, an official from the Prime Minister’s Office, two think tank researchers and one from the Secret Service. A Bangladesh expert from Assam spoke to Mirror Asia. He said that Hasina’s dream of connecting the North East with the mainland of India has been completely shattered. BNP will not cooperate with India in this regard. The new political party will be much more youth oriented, speaking more in the language of politics than diplomacy. He even pointed out that some of their decisions could pose a security risk to the Seven Sisters.
